Output 92e266b054e95b67ad092965e5264c4f1a0dba1cfd23ce0c44f6da514b3ab635:3

value
3457569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530f1b4790f793af9a48ca977f8c3e2afde9bb49 OP_EQUAL
address
39GC7642EWi5VtGea3ZjW9jnMvKiFUuMfZ
transaction
92e266b054e95b67ad092965e5264c4f1a0dba1cfd23ce0c44f6da514b3ab635
confirmations
423250
spent
true